Como instalar o Kernel 5.0 no Ubuntu e derivados?

Linux Kernel

Linux Kernel

Recentemente foi lançada esta nova versão do Linux Kernel 5.0 que adiciona alguns novos recursos significativos e algumas outras novidades dos quais podemos destacar o agendador de tarefas com ARM big.LITTLE CPU baseado em Android, Mecanismo de criptografia do sistema de arquivos Adiantum, suporte à tecnologia FreeSync no driver AMDGPU, o sistema de arquivos BinderFS, a capacidade de colocar o arquivo de paginação em Btrfs e muito mais.

Como você bem sabe o kernel é responsável pela alocação de recursos, interfaces de hardware de baixo nível, segurança, comunicações simples, gerenciamento básico de sistema de arquivos e muito mais.

Escrito do zero por Linus Torvalds (com a ajuda de vários desenvolvedores), Linux é voltado para especificações POSIX e especificações UNIX apenas.

Por isso, ter o Kernel atualizado é fundamental para o ótimo funcionamento do equipamento.
Inicialmente projetado apenas para computadores baseados em 386/486, o Linux agora oferece suporte a uma ampla gama de arquiteturas, incluindo 64 bits (IA64, AMD64), ARM, ARM64, DEC Alpha, MIPS, SUN Sparc, PowerPC e muitos mais.

Instalação do Kernel 5.0

Apesar do Kernel 5.0 ter sido lançado há algumas horas, os desenvolvedores responsáveis ​​pelo kernel do sistema Ubuntu já fizeram as compilações necessárias para disponibilizá-las aos usuários.
Pacotes com os quais nos apoiaremos para podermos atualizar o núcleo do nosso sistema para esta nova versão lançada.

É importante mencionar que para instalar esta nova versão do Kernel Linux devemos baixar os pacotes correspondentes à arquitetura do nosso sistema, bem como a versão que queremos instalar.

Pelo que este método é válido para qualquer versão do Ubuntu que seja atualmente suportada, isto é, Ubuntu 14.04 LTS, Ubuntu 16.04 LTS, Ubuntu 18.04 LTS e a nova versão do Ubuntu que é a versão 18.10, bem como seus derivados.

Se você não conhece a arquitetura do seu sistema, poderá descobrir abrindo um terminal com Ctrl + Alt + T e nele digitará o seguinte comando:

uname -m

Onde se você receber uma resposta com "x86" significa que seu sistema é de 32 bits e se você receber um "x86_64" significa que seu sistema é de 64 bits.

Agora com essas informações você poderá saber quais são os pacotes que correspondem à arquitetura do processador do seu computador.

Kernel 5.0

Para quem ainda usa sistemas de 32 bits é necessário baixar os seguintes pacotes, para isso vamos abrir um terminal e nele executar os seguintes comandos:

wget kernel.ubuntu.com/~kernel-ppa/mainline/v5.0/linux-headers-5.0.0-050000_5.0.0-050000.201903032031_all.deb

wget kernel.ubuntu.com/~kernel-ppa/mainline/v5.0/linux-headers-5.0.0-050000-generic_5.0.0-050000.201903032031_i386.deb

wget kernel.ubuntu.com/~kernel-ppa/mainline/v5.0/linux-image-5.0.0-050000-generic_5.0.0-050000.201903032031_i386.deb

wget kernel.ubuntu.com/~kernel-ppa/mainline/v5.0/linux-modules-5.0.0-050000-generic_5.0.0-050000.201903032031_i386.deb

No caso daqueles que são Para usuários do sistema de 64 bits, os pacotes correspondentes à arquitetura do processador são os seguintes:

 wget kernel.ubuntu.com/~kernel-ppa/mainline/v5.0/linux-headers-5.0.0-050000_5.0.0-050000.201903032031_all.deb

wget kernel.ubuntu.com/~kernel-ppa/mainline/v5.0/linux-headers-5.0.0-050000-generic_5.0.0-050000.201903032031_amd64.deb

wget kernel.ubuntu.com/~kernel-ppa/mainline/v5.0/linux-image-unsigned-5.0.0-050000-generic_5.0.0-050000.201903032031_amd64.deb

wget kernel.ubuntu.com/~kernel-ppa/mainline/v5.0/linux-modules-5.0.0-050000-generic_5.0.0-050000.201903032031_amd64.deb

Ao final da instalação dos pacotes, basta executar o seguinte comando para instalá-los no sistema.

sudo dpkg -i linux-headers-5.0.0*.deb linux-image-unsigned-5.0.0*.deb linux-modules-5.0.0*.deb

Instalação de baixa latência do Linux Kernel 5.0

No caso de kernels de baixa latência, os pacotes que devem ser baixados são os seguintes, Para aqueles que são usuários de 32 bits, eles devem fazer o download destes:

wget kernel.ubuntu.com/~kernel-ppa/mainline/v5.0/linux-headers-5.0.0-050000_5.0.0-050000.201903032031_all.deb

wget kernel.ubuntu.com/~kernel-ppa/mainline/v5.0/linux-headers-5.0.0-050000-lowlatency_5.0.0-050000.201903032031_i386.deb

wget kernel.ubuntu.com/~kernel-ppa/mainline/v5.0/linux-image-5.0.0-050000-lowlatency_5.0.0-050000.201903032031_i386.deb
wget kernel.ubuntu.com/~kernel-ppa/mainline/v5.0/linux-modules-5.0.0-050000-lowlatency_5.0.0-050000.201903032031_i386.deb

O para aqueles que usam sistemas de 64 bits os pacotes para download são os seguintes:

wget kernel.ubuntu.com/~kernel-ppa/mainline/v5.0/linux-headers-5.0.0-050000_5.0.0-050000.201903032031_all.deb
wget kernel.ubuntu.com/~kernel-ppa/mainline/v5.0/linux-headers-5.0.0-050000-lowlatency_5.0.0-050000.201903032031_amd64.deb 
wget kernel.ubuntu.com/~kernel-ppa/mainline/v5.0/linux-image-unsigned-5.0.0-050000-lowlatency_5.0.0-050000.201903032031_amd64.deb 
wget kernel.ubuntu.com/~kernel-ppa/mainline/v5.0/linux-modules-5.0.0-050000-lowlatency_5.0.0-050000.201903032031_amd64.deb

Finalmente, podemos instalar qualquer um desses pacotes com o seguinte comando:

sudo dpkg -i linux-headers-5.0.0*.deb linux-image-unsigned-5.0.0*.deb linux-modules-5.0.0*.deb

Finalmente, só temos que reiniciar nosso sistema para que quando o iniciarmos novamente, nosso sistema funciona com a nova versão do Kernel que acabamos de instalar.

Como instalar o Kernel 5.0 com Ukuu?

Instale o Kernel 5.0

Si você é um novato ou pensa que pode bagunçar seu sistema seguindo os passos acima, você pode usar uma ferramenta que pode ajudá-lo a simplificar o processo de instalação do kernel.

Já falei em um artigo anterior sobre essa ferramenta Ukuu, que você pode conhecer e instalar no link abaixo.

Basta rodar a aplicação no sistema depois de instalada e o programa tem a mesma facilidade de atualizar o Kernel é muito e simples.

Uma lista de kernels é postada no site kernel.ubuntu.com. e mostra notificações quando uma nova atualização do kernel está disponível.


Deixe um comentário

Seu endereço de email não será publicado. Campos obrigatórios são marcados com *

*

*

  1. Responsável pelos dados: Miguel Ángel Gatón
  2. Finalidade dos dados: Controle de SPAM, gerenciamento de comentários.
  3. Legitimação: Seu consentimento
  4. Comunicação de dados: Os dados não serão comunicados a terceiros, exceto por obrigação legal.
  5. Armazenamento de dados: banco de dados hospedado pela Occentus Networks (UE)
  6. Direitos: A qualquer momento você pode limitar, recuperar e excluir suas informações.

  1.   Franz dito

    Se eu fizer este método no Ubuntu 16.04.6 obtenho um erro libssl1.1, o Ubuntu Xenial funciona com a biblioteca libssl1.0, seria muito bom encontrar uma solução sem precisar migrar para o Ubuntu 18.04.2, porque o Xenial é muito estável.
    http://djfranz.vivaldi.net

  2.   OLMER dito

    Boa noite. Se eu usar a ferramenta Ukuu, para instalar o Kernel 5.0 no xubuntu, como posso saber se o aplicativo instalou o Kernel 5.0 no sistema de 64 bits, que é o que tenho atualmente.

    1.    David Orange dito

      A mesma ferramenta marca os kernels que você tem no sistema. Saudações.

    2.    Nasher_87 (ARG) dito

      Instale todos, 32 e 64, mas ative apenas 64